Subject: [SanDiegoRegionBirding] Miscellaneous including Franklin's update
Around 8:30 a.m. Sunday morning, presumably the same lingering Franklins Gull that had been in the east arm of Lower Otay Lake is now swimming around with Bonapartes in the north arm as viewed from along Wueste Road. Clearly the birds move around various parts of the lake. Earlier this morning there's a calling Ridgways Rail at the top end of Sweetwater Reservoir, which I believe is the first record for Sweetwater and adds another new inland locale for this species. A seawatch yesterday at La Jolla was pretty uneventful though there were moderate numbers of Sooty Shearwaters feeding close to shore early on.
